Property description

38 Veasy Park is a great example of an adaptable, comfortable property set back from the road in one of Wembury’s most popular, quieter locations.
Built in 1983, on a generous plot, the property has been updated and beautifully maintained, offering an adaptable layout - ideal for multi-generational living (with scope to convert a current dressing room into a small second kitchen), letting potential or providing 2 main reception rooms either side of the show stopping kitchen (installed November 2022) where natural light floods in and easy access out to the private patio and lawned rear garden enhances everyday living.
The window seat in the dual aspect sitting room is a particularly pleasing feature along with the wood burning stove. The master ensuite shower room has been stylishly upgraded with attention to design and detail. The master bedroom itself overlooks the well-stocked, established private back garden with its summer house, green house and timber archway leading around to the delightful, low maintenance paved side garden outside the current annex; here a shed houses charger points for a motor home.
The ample driveway has parking for several cars, with the established front lawn and vegetable garden being the outlooks for the second and third bedrooms, catching the evening sun.

Location
The large village of Wembury, boasts many amenities including a Post Office and Stores, The Odd Wheel pub, a thriving primary school, and a doctors’ surgery. It is most well-known for its National Trust owned beach, with the Wembury Marine Centre, feature rock-pools for family time well spent, a café, and the popular landmark of St Werburgh’s Church. The fabulous coastline, accessible by the Southwest Coast Path extends to the Yealm Estuary, Heybrook Bay and Bovisand. Away from tourist routes, Wembury, is a location that offers a “best of both worlds”, surrounded by open countryside yet only approx. 3 miles from Plymouth, the suburb of Plymstock, and 6 miles from the city centre and scenic Barbican waterfront.
